Is online tutoring effective for a practical subject like Music?

It is, and it works brilliantly. With high-quality video and audio, tutors can demonstrate techniques, listen to your child play, and provide instant feedback. Our online classroom has interactive whiteboards perfect for explaining music theory. It offers all the benefits of in-person lessons with added convenience and a wider choice of specialist tutors.

Can a tutor help with specific things like ABRSM grade exams or music theory?

Yes, absolutely. Many of our tutors specialise in preparing students for grade exams (like ABRSM or Trinity), and can provide targeted support for music theory, aural tests, and sight-reading. You can use the filters when searching to find a tutor with the exact experience your child needs.
